FIRST MODERN OFFICE PROJECT IN PRAGUE 9 | 01.10.2007

The project at the intersection of Prosecká and Vysočanská streets fulfils the requirements for traffic accessibility both by car and particularly by public transport. Metro line C station ‘Prosek’ will be right next to the buildings. The three modern towers of ‘PROSEK POINT’ will be completed gradually in the years 2008–2009 and will offer 26,000 sq m of space. PROSEK POINT will thus become the first modern office centre in Prague 9 and neighbouring Prague 8.

TRAFFIC ACCESSIBILITY
“The continually rising demands on the traffic accessibility of office projects were one of the most important criteria in choosing the locality,” says Ing. Radek Spurný, Project Manager of J&T REAL ESTATE. “We intentionally prepared the construction schedule so that the new phase of the extended metro line C would be in operation when the first building is opened,” adds Mr Spurný. PROSEK POINT is easily accessible by car from the city centre, and offers excellent connection to the city ring road and highways to Teplice, Hradec Králové and the highspeed motorway to Mladá Boleslav.
The Vysočany and Libeň train stations are also located nearby. The new metro C station is right next to the building and the metro line B is just one bus stop away.

VARIABILITY OF SPACE
The second to eighth floors house large open-space offices. Each floor (950–1,100 sq m) can be divided into smaller units. This offers greater flexibility in organising office space.
The administrative areas are fully equipped with suspended ceilings and doubled floors. The building is fully air conditioned and fitted throughout with modern sprinklers to ensure fire protection.

SERVICES RIGHT IN THE AREA
The ground floors of the individual buildings will be offered as commercial premises, and a restaurant and café are planned in the central tower. Relaxation zones with vegetation and beautiful views of Prague are planned on the roofs of the buildings. The vicinity around PROSEK POINT contains a wide range of services including banks, a post office, shopping centres and restaurants.
The newly constructed park, which follows up on the existing vegetation, can be used for rest or pleasant work meetings.
